I planned a ladybug party for her. The traditional red and black with bits of white here and there. It was a lot of fun to plan as it was challenging. Now days everything lady bug is all different colors... bleh! So having to come up with different ideas and putting twist on things. That was a lot of fun. First I made a balloon wreath. Black,red, and white. That was a bunch of fun. I used a straw wreath and kept the plastic on it. Greening pins and TONS of balloons. Put the pin in the middle of the balloon...then stick it on the wreath.. SUPER CUTE! If I say so myself. =)

The large lady bug is a 1/2 ball pan with fondant with black licorice antenna. The little lady bugs are fondant. This was the first time I worked with fondant. It was a lot easier than I thought and was kinda fun. Plus everyone said it was yummy so that helps! =) The little lady bugs were "buzzing" around. Ah it was soo soo cute!
